Samburu luxury tented camp with stunning location, excellent guides, and the kind of wildlife encounters that justify premium pricing. Food is solid bush-to-table style, staff are attentive, and the whole setup balances comfort with authentic safari atmosphere. Best for those doing Samburu properly and willing to pay for quality.
